2007–08 Arizona State Sun Devils men's basketball team
American college basketball season / From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
The 2007–08 Arizona State Sun Devils men's basketball team represented Arizona State University during the 2007–08 NCAA Division I men's basketball season. The Sun Devils played their home games at the Wells Fargo Arena and were members of the Pacific-10 Conference. The Sun Devils finished with 21–13, 9–9 in Pac-10 play. They were invited to play in the 2008 National Invitation Tournament where they beat Alabama State and Southern Illinois.[1][2] They subsequently lost in the quarter finals to Florida.[3]
